Renting a Rolls-Royce in 2025: An Expert’s Guide to Cost & Considerations

Renting a Rolls-Royce isn’t just about getting from point A to point B. It’s about making a statement. It’s about experiencing a level of luxury and refinement that’s simply unmatched. Whether you’re planning a lavish wedding, need a show-stopping arrival for a crucial business meeting, or simply want to indulge in the ultimate driving experience, a Rolls-Royce rental elevates the occasion.

After a decade in the luxury car rental industry, I’ve seen firsthand how renting a Rolls-Royce can transform an event. But before you dive in, it’s crucial to understand the costs involved and how to navigate the rental process to get the best value. Let’s break down the factors that influence the price of a Rolls-Royce rental in 2025, and how to make the most of your investment.

What Drives the Price of a Rolls-Royce Rental?

Several elements contribute to the final cost. Understanding these allows you to make informed decisions and potentially save some serious cash.

Model Matters:

Phantom: The undisputed king of the Rolls-Royce lineup. Expect daily rates starting around \$2,500 and easily exceeding \$3,500, depending on the specific model year, features, and location. Consider the extended wheelbase version for even more rear passenger space and a more imposing presence.

Ghost: A slightly more “accessible” Rolls-Royce, but still dripping in luxury. Daily rates generally fall between \$1,800 and \$2,500. The Ghost is a great option for those who want the Rolls-Royce experience without the Phantom’s imposing size.

Wraith: The sporty coupe of the family. A grand tourer with a powerful engine and sleek design. Expect to pay around \$1,700 – \$2,200 per day. The Wraith caters to drivers who appreciate a more engaging driving experience.

Dawn: The convertible Rolls-Royce. Perfect for cruising down the coast or making a grand entrance at an outdoor event. Prices typically range from \$2,000 to \$2,500 daily. Be mindful of weather conditions, as the open-top experience is best enjoyed in optimal climates.

Cullinan: The Rolls-Royce SUV. The ultimate in luxury and capability, the Cullinan commands a premium. Daily rates generally start at \$2,200 and can climb to \$3,000 or more. The Cullinan is a popular choice for families or those who need the extra space and versatility of an SUV without sacrificing luxury.

Electric Spectre: Rolls-Royce’s entry into the EV realm is creating significant buzz. Given its advanced technology and limited availability in 2025, expect daily rates to be at the higher end, potentially surpassing even the Phantom. Pre-booking is essential if you want to experience this groundbreaking vehicle.

Rental Duration: The Longer, The Cheaper (Per Day):

Single Day: Expect to pay the highest daily rate. Ideal for short-term needs like weddings or special events.
Weekend Packages: Look for slight discounts for 2-3 day rentals. A great option for weekend getaways or exploring a city in style.
Weekly Rentals: Savings of 10-20% on the daily rate are common. Consider this for extended vacations or business trips where you want consistent luxury.
Monthly Rentals: The most cost-effective option, reducing the daily rate by as much as 25-30%. Perfect for extended stays, business assignments, or those who want to experience Rolls-Royce ownership without the commitment.

Location, Location, Location: Premium Markets, Premium Prices:

Major Metropolitan Areas: Cities like New York, Los Angeles, Miami, London, Paris, and Dubai command higher prices due to demand and operating costs. Expect to pay a premium in these locations.
Smaller Cities: You might find slightly lower rates in less saturated markets. Consider this if you’re willing to travel a bit to pick up the vehicle.
Competition Matters: Cities with multiple luxury car rental providers often offer more competitive pricing. Do your research and compare rates from different companies.

Seasonality and Events: Timing is Everything:

Peak Seasons: Prices surge during summer months (June-August), holidays (Christmas, New Year’s), and major events (Fashion Week, Grand Prix, Film Festivals). Booking well in advance is crucial during these times.
Off-Season: Consider renting during the shoulder seasons (spring and fall) for potentially lower rates and better availability.
Weekends vs. Weekdays: Weekends typically command higher prices due to increased demand. Renting during the week can save you money.

The Extras: Customization Comes at a Cost:

Chauffeur Services: Adding a professional chauffeur will typically cost an extra \$400-\$600 per day. Worth it for those who want to relax and enjoy the ride or need to focus on other tasks.
Delivery and Collection: In-city delivery is often included, but expect extra charges for remote locations or airport pickups.
Wedding Packages: Custom decorations, ribbons, and other enhancements can add to the cost. Be sure to clarify what’s included in the package.
Mileage Limits: Standard mileage allowances are typically 100-150 miles per day. Exceeding this will result in per-mile charges, usually ranging from \$3-\$6 per mile. Plan your routes carefully to minimize these charges.
Insurance Upgrades: Reducing your liability with enhanced insurance coverage will add to the daily cost. Weigh the benefits of lower risk against the added expense.

Premium Audio System Upgrade: Many renters are opting for bespoke audio upgrades to truly appreciate the Rolls-Royce’s exceptional sound insulation. This add-on can increase the rental cost, but audiophiles find it worthwhile.

2025 Rolls-Royce Rental Rates: A Snapshot

Here’s a general idea of what you can expect to pay in Europe and the US for a Rolls-Royce rental in 2025:

ModelDaily Rate (USD)
Ghost\$1,800 – \$2,500
Phantom\$2,500 – \$3,500+
Wraith\$1,700 – \$2,200
Dawn\$2,000 – \$2,500
Cullinan\$2,200 – \$3,000+
Spectre\$3,000 +

Note: These are average prices and can vary depending on the factors mentioned above. Base prices usually include standard insurance and basic mileage.

Hourly Rolls-Royce Rental (with Chauffeur): The Short-Term Solution

For weddings, airport transfers, or corporate events where you only need the car for a few hours, hourly rentals with a chauffeur are a popular option. Expect a minimum commitment of 3-4 hours.

ModelHourly Rate (USD)
Phantom\$300 – \$400
Ghost\$250 – \$350
Cullinan\$300 – \$350

Note: Short-term bookings include preparation, delivery, and cleaning costs, which are factored into the pricing.

Hidden Costs: Be Prepared

Don’t get caught off guard by unexpected expenses. Here are some common additional costs to consider:

Security Deposit: Ranging from \$5,000 to \$10,000 (refundable, assuming no damage or excessive wear and tear).
Fuel: The car must be returned with a full tank. Rolls-Royces are not known for their fuel efficiency, so budget accordingly.
Insurance Excess: Ranging from \$1,000 to \$5,000, depending on the level of coverage.
Cleaning Fees: May apply for excessive dirt or stains. Treat the car with respect to avoid these charges.
Chauffeur Gratuity: Customary 10-20% if using a chauffeur.

Smart Strategies for Saving Money on Your Rolls-Royce Rental

Luxury doesn’t have to break the bank. Here are some proven tips for reducing your rental costs:

Book Well in Advance: Securing your rental early, especially during peak seasons, can significantly lower the price.
Extend Your Rental: Opting for a longer rental duration (weekly or monthly) will reduce the daily rate considerably.
Choose Weekdays: Weekday rentals are typically cheaper than weekend rentals due to lower demand.
Plan Your Routes: Carefully plan your routes to minimize mileage and avoid exceeding the allowed limit.
Consider Older Models: Opting for a slightly older model year can still provide a luxurious experience at a lower price point.
Look for Package Deals: Some rental companies offer bundled services (e.g., chauffeur + decorations for weddings) at discounted rates.
Compare Rental Companies: Use online tools to compare pricing between different luxury rental providers.
Negotiate: Don’t be afraid to negotiate with rental companies, especially if you’re renting for an extended period.

Is a Rolls-Royce Rental Worth the Investment?

That depends on your priorities. If you’re looking to make a statement, create a memorable experience, or simply indulge in the pinnacle of automotive luxury, then absolutely. Renting a Rolls-Royce is more than just transportation; it’s an experience that reflects success, elegance, and confidence.

The Future of Rolls-Royce Rentals: Electric and Sustainable

Looking ahead, the luxury car rental market is evolving. The rise of electric vehicles, like the Rolls-Royce Spectre, is changing the landscape. Consider these factors for 2025 and beyond:

Increased Demand for EVs: As environmental awareness grows, expect higher demand for electric luxury vehicles like the Spectre.
Charging Infrastructure: Inquire about charging options and availability when renting an EV. Ensure the rental company provides charging solutions or guidance.
Sustainable Practices: Seek out rental companies committed to sustainable practices, such as carbon offsetting programs or investments in eco-friendly technologies.
